closed Luca Missoni. Moon Atlas

Curated by: Maurizio Bortolotti

The show

From 24 November 2019 to 19 January 2020, the MA * GA hosts the personal exhibition of Luca Missoni (born in 1956), he has always cultivated a great passion for the Moon. The interest in this celestial body originates in his childhood when he began to explore its surface with a small telescope , right in the 1960s when space programs made possible the first lunar explorations. Subsequently this passion led him to photograph in a rigorous, almost scientific way, the changing appearance of the Moon, pursuing over the years his own artistic project which is realized in the publication of a Moon Altlas . To do this, Missoni always photographs the Moon from the same position and with the same instrument. The color obtained during the printing of his negatives constitutes one of the two main variables in his project: the other is, of course, the shadow line that marks the phases.

"Photographing the Moon has become like scientific research," says Missoni. "To see how it changes in terms of light on the surface, I have always tried to replicate the same dimensions and shades."
